Payroll Service Team Leader

Location: Weybridge, with travel to ISS offices and client sites as required

Join ISS and build your career with us: We’re looking for an experienced Payroll Service Team Leader to join our Payroll function at ISS and play a key role in delivering an exceptional experience for our placemakers.

ISS is a global workplace experience and facilities management organisation, operating across more than 30 countries and employing hundreds of thousands of people worldwide. Our people are at the heart of what we do, and our Payroll teams play a vital role in supporting them.

This is an opportunity to join a large, established and continually evolving organisation, where you can make an impact, develop your expertise and build a long-term career.

What you’ll do

  • Lead the day-to-day activities of the Payroll Service Team, ensuring workloads and SLAs are effectively managed.
  • Coach, support and develop Payroll Service Advisors through feedback, training and performance management.
  • Act as the escalation point for complex, sensitive or unresolved payroll queries.
  • Monitor team performance, quality and productivity against KPIs and SLAs.
  • Analyse service data and customer feedback to identify trends, root causes and improvements.
  • Build strong relationships with Payroll Delivery and key stakeholders to resolve issues and enhance the service.
  • Promote best practice and a culture of continuous improvement.

What you’ll bring

  • Proven payroll and customer service experience.
  • Experience coaching, mentoring or supervising a team.
  • Strong understanding of UK payroll legislation and processes.
  • Excellent communication and stakeholder management skills.
  • Ability to manage competing priorities and meet deadlines.
